Rotary Engineering's Jv Unit Secures US$34mln Contract In Saudi Arabia
SINGAPORE, Feb 14 (Bernama) -- A joint venture unit of Rotary Engineering
Ltd has secured a US$34 million Engineering, Procurement and Construction (EPC)
contract to build 17 field storage tanks in Saudi Arabia.
The contract relates to the US$1.23 billion Shoaiba II Combined Cycle Power
Plant Project in Shoaiba, some 120 km south of the Red Sea city of Jeddah.
It was awarded to Rotary’s joint venture company Petrol Steel Co. Ltd. by
South Korea’s Daelim Group, which is the main contractor for the project.
The combined-cycle plant, which is owned by the Saudi
Electricity Co, will have a power capacity of 1,238 megawatt when completed.
The contract will see Rotary building 17 field storage tanks which will
primarily be used to store fuel oil.
Announcing this here Tuesday, Rotary chairman and managing director, Chia
Kim Piow said: "We are hopeful and optimistic that more opportunities will open
to us as we continue to fortify our presence in Saudi Arabia."
Work is scheduled to start in June and is expected to be completed around
mid 2013.
Rotary Engineering provides engineering, procurement, construction and
maintenance services serving the oil & gas and petrochemical sectors.
